Introducing... Tyler Thomas Miles!


After 27 hours of intense labor we brought Tyler Thomas Miles into the world at 4:00pm on Friday, February 13th, 2009. He weighed in at just 5lbs 6 ounces and measured 19 inches long.






Tyler was born 3 and a half weeks early but he is healthy, happy and doing excellently. We are very blessed to have this beautiful bundle of joy!


I was induced after 9 days of bed rest on Thursday, February 12th at 1:00pm due to pregnancy complications from pre-eclampsia. I had the epidural from heck and my contractions were very difficult. They were 2 minutes apart for about 8 hours and I was only dilated to a one until Friday morning around 8:00am.








Once I was dilated to a three and holding, Erik gave me a priesthood blessing and within two hours I was at a 10 and ready to start pushing. Up until that point I had to be "revived" a couple of times when my blood pressure dropped to 60/30 from 125/90 and I wasn't breathing very well.

I pushed about 5 times once I was dilated to a 10 and out he came! The pain was horrible, but of course it was all worth it. I didn't even need any stitches! After such a hard pregnancy and difficult labor, the pushing was relatively quick and easy--I felt very blessed.

Tyler is doing so well now. He sleeps soundly, eats like a champ and fills his diapers faster than Daddy can change them. We are all very tired and I'm still in some pain, but our little family is happy and healthy!
